No, it is a payment system, not a pseudo currency. Think of it as an open-source Paypal.
It has been used as a digital voucher system on some events, and there is afaik a trial with a inofficial regional currency somewhere in Italy.
But mainly people are currently waiting for the first bank to offer an option to charge your Taler wallet with Euros. There is a German coop bank that plans to do so in the comming weeks.
